CVE-2019-9575 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. The Quiz And Survey Master plugin 6.0.4 for WordPress allows wp-admin/admin.php?page=mlw_quiz_results quiz_id XSS.. EPSS estimates a 1.61%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
The Quiz And Survey Master plugin 6.0.4 for WordPress allows wp-admin/admin.php?page=mlw_quiz_results quiz_id XSS.
